+# How to contribute to lego
+
+Contributions in the form of patches and proposals are essential to keep lego great and to make it even better.
+To ensure a great and easy experience for everyone, please review the few guidelines in this document.
+
+## Bug reports
+
+- Use the issue search to see if the issue has already been reported.
+- Also look for closed issues to see if your issue has already been fixed.
+- If both of the above do not apply create a new issue and include as much information as possible.
+
+Bug reports should include all information a person could need to reproduce your problem without the need to
+follow up for more information. If possible, provide detailed steps for us to reproduce it, the expected behaviour and the actual behaviour.
+
+## Feature proposals and requests
+
+Feature requests are welcome and should be discussed in an issue.
+Please keep proposals focused on one thing at a time and be as detailed as possible.
+It is up to you to make a strong point about your proposal and convince us of the merits and the added complexity of this feature.
+
+## Pull requests
+
+Patches, new features and improvements are a great way to help the project.
+Please keep them focused on one thing and do not include unrelated commits.
+
+All pull requests which alter the behaviour of the program, add new behaviour or somehow alter code in a non-trivial way should **always** include tests.
+
+If you want to contribute a significant pull request (with a non-trivial workload for you) please **ask first**. We do not want you to spend
+a lot of time on something the project's developers might not want to merge into the project.
+
+**IMPORTANT**: By submitting a patch, you agree to allow the project
+owners to license your work under the terms of the [MIT License](LICENSE).
